About Fives Group
Fives Group, headquartered in Paris, France, is an industrial engineering group founded in 1812 that designs and supplies machines, process equipment and production lines for the world's largest industrial groups including the aluminum, steel, tube and pipe, glass, automotive, aerospace, logistics, cement, and energy sectors. In 2018, Fives achieved sales of $2 billion with a team of close to 8,500 employees and a network of over 100 operational units in over 25 countries.

Accountability:

  • Providing accurate, relevant, and timely financial information
  • Establishing and monitoring financial policies, procedures, controls and reporting systems.

Scope and Responsibilities:
Essential duties include, but are not limited to the following:

  • Keeps management properly informed of the division's performance and provides advice on all financial matters.
  • Develops and presents issues to management that require attention or decisions.
  • Recommends and implements ideas to grow revenue, cut costs, reduce networking assets or improve networking asset turnover.
  • Minimizes transaction costs.
  • Responsible for and participates in the preparation and execution of financial plans.
  • Updates financial projections, anticipates potential variances, buffers risk with cushions, analyzes options and makes recommendations towards solutions.
  • Coordinates, administers, and participates in the development of strategic plans. Key components should include bookings and sales forecasts, backlog, expense budgets, required capital and working capital.
  • Partners with management and ensures the successful execution of the financial plans.
  • Compares actual performance against the current operating plan.
  • Highlights and explains variances to plan and recommends corrective action.
  • Provides and interprets result reports for all levels of management including weekly, monthly, and quarterly financial reports, flash updates and other performance measurement reports as needed.
  • Provides other departments with relevant financial information required to carry out assigned responsibilities.
  • Ensures internal controls and procedures are in compliance with applicable US accepted accounting principles (GAAP).
  • Conducts self-audits to ensure the integrity of financial information on a periodic basis.
  • Provides information to external auditors as required.
  • Ensures sales are properly costed and inventory is properly reconciled.
  • Performs weekly/monthly margin reviews and discusses results with management.
  • Monitors inventory levels and partners with management to ensure appropriate policies and procedures are in place to minimize inventory obsolescence.
  • Works closely with other department groups on problems involving accounting systems and financial planning.
